The forerunner of modern medical records, researchers have discovered, first appeared in Paris and Berlin by the early 19th century. It was not until the 20th century that a clinical medical record useful for direct patient care in hospital and ambulatory settings was developed and used regularly. All patients / clients who come into contact with a healthcare professional will have details of that contact documented in their clinical record (also called the medical record).These details are usually in the form of notes on the assessment, treatment, progress and ultimate plan for the patient and can be summarised in the SOAP format.
